β¦ Synopsis
In this paper, a novel automated vision system is introduced to detect and assess the welding defects of gas pipelines from the radiographic films. The proposed vision system was used to capture images for the radiographic films and apply various image processing and computer vision algorithms to detect the welding defects and to calculate necessary information such as length, width, area and perimeter of the defects. A developed software, named AutoWDA, has been fully written in lab using Microsoft Visual CΓΎΓΎ6 to perform the analysis process. The proposed system offers many advantages such as enhancing the captured images so that the defects appear much clear and eliminating the loss of image details, which occurs due to film deterioration by the time, by transferring the radiographic films into digitized images, which could be saved on magnetic mass storage media. The proposed system is considered quite cheap compared with commercial radiographic image enhancement systems.
